Transaction 58cf729eec5d8834bc56fbc1c384f7e239ceb6e5201a656b433646131f696d70

1 Input
2 Outputs
  • 58cf729eec5d8834bc56fbc1c384f7e239ceb6e5201a656b433646131f696d70:0
  • value  1773850
    address  1BPcK3WgYNho6RfaZpGUUvHiZCx8fctyTt
  • 58cf729eec5d8834bc56fbc1c384f7e239ceb6e5201a656b433646131f696d70:1
  • value  1962306
    address  13Qzmt7HL3iyWgETyvgNxyouHhz4MyKShb